Did you make sure you got your pads and helmets on for the Grand Finale of American Gladiators last night? Season 2 closed with one male contender and one female battler emerging as our new champions!


Semi-Finals Combatants

Monday night, all mayhem of Season 2 finally came to an end as American Gladiators aired its two-hour finale. Two competitors — one man and one woman — fought their way through to the very end, and won the money - $100,000, a brand new Toyota Sequoia, and the title of Grand Champion! This last show of the season featured the third semi-finals round in the first hour, and determined who among the remaining 4 finalists would actually compete in the second hour's finale.

The show began with hosts Hulk Hogan and Laila Ali explaining how each hour of the 2 part finale show would commence. This was it! In the first hour, it was one more wild semi-finals round, and one last chance for our remaining 4 semi-finalists to make their mark against the Gladiators, and try and secure a spot in the Final Four Grand Finale!

And now people - it's the Grand Finale! 2 will win it all and become our new Gladiator Champions! The men go first and Tim has a 12.5 second head start. And of he course, ran another phenomenal Eliminator. He was climbing the cargo net by the second whistle. He kept his massive lead and flew across all obstacles on the course. He ran up the travelator on his first try and did a back flip into the water. His time was 1:21. Yay - Tim won! He thanked the gladiators for beating him into shape. With Mike's delayed start, he had a little bit of trouble early on at the top of the cargo net but was able to stay up on the hand bike. Mike barely reached the top of the pyramid as Tim was finishing the race. Mike slipped off the seesaw but made it up the travelator on his first try. His time was 1:46 - very fast for 2nd place.

In the ladies Eliminator Challenge, Tiffaney had a 5 second head start but had a bit of trouble on the cargo net. She made it to the top second and fell behind Ally on the rest of the course. Tiffaney almost made it across the hand bike but fell right before the end. She made it to the seesaw as Ally was finishing the race. She then struggled with the travelator for quite some time. Tiffaney swung into the pool without breaking the finish line paper. Her time was 4:07. And our winner Ally, overcame Tiffaney’s head start and passed her on the cargo net. She fell off the hand bike but ran through all other obstacles with ease. She made it up the travelator on her first try and swung into the water. Her husband and other family members followed her into the pool to celebrate. Her time was 1:46. This was the fastest female time for this season - Yay for Ally.

So there you have it America. Ally Davidson and Tim Oliphant are our new American Gladiator Champions! A big congratulations to them both for winning. And I have to say thank you to such a great show for keeping me entirely entertained all season long! Long Live American Gladiators!
